
Sims Specula — Pattern and Clinical Use
The Sims retracts one vaginal wall — usually the posterior wall — while an assistant holds it, exposing the anterior wall and cervix. It is not self-retaining, and that is the point: it gives the operator complete freedom over the direction and degree of retraction, which suits vaginal surgery, repair procedures and examinations where a fixed bivalve would obstruct access.
Because it is held throughout, blade balance and handle comfort matter to the assistant. The two ends carry different blade sizes so one instrument covers two exposure requirements.

Material, Finish and Quality Control
We forge Sims specula from 316L austenitic stainless. Both blade ends are finished to the same standard and balance checked, since the instrument is hand-held throughout a procedure. Each batch passes Rockwell hardness testing, dimensional checks on blade finish parity and balance, and visual inspection under our ISO 13485 system before passivation and final finishing. Mirror and satin finishes are both available — satin is usually specified where glare under operating lights is a concern.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is a Sims speculum self-retaining?
No. It is held by an assistant, which gives complete control over the direction and degree of retraction — useful where a fixed bivalve would obstruct access.
Why is it double-ended?
The two ends carry different blade sizes, so one instrument covers two exposure requirements without swapping.
What is it usually paired with?
An Auvard weighted speculum for posterior retraction, with the Sims retracting the anterior wall.
